In these cases, customers dispute legitimate charges with their credit card companies, falsely claiming non-receipt of goods or dissatisfaction with services received. Retailers should leverage velocity checks to detect suspicious activity on their platforms. Another prevalent method is the abuse of chargeback systems.
Experts report that chargebacks will cost merchants over $100 billion in 2023, and false claims and abuse of the chargeback process are a growing threat to merchants. Retail digital transformation is the process of leveraging technology to fundamentally change the way a retail businessoperates. It involves integrating digital tools and processes across all aspects of the business, from product development and marketing to sales and customer service.
Enter low-code, which abstracts away many of the hurdles from the consumer-facing app development process. The low-code approach is built around a visual interface that allows users to assemble drag-and-drop code components, API-based services, machine learning, IoT capabilities and model-driven logic, and do it with Lego-like simplicity.
